Summary:
A collection of 176 cartes de visite or photographic portraits of various American, British, and European artists active during the second half of the 19th century, assembled by an unidentified previous owner and housed in a commercially-produced blank album.The photographs originate from a number of different photography studios, including Bayard & Bertall, Bingham, Matthew Brady, Carjat & Cie., H.G. DeBurlo, Disdéri, Franck, F. Joubert, McLean & Co., Mayer & Pierson, Ernst Milster, Nadar, Pierre Petit, Ch. Reutlinger, Richards, and others.

General note:
Title devised by cataloger.
Added title transcribed from gilt- and black-printed t.p., which reads: Photograph album, Philadelphia, Wm. S. & A. Martien. The publishing house of Wm. S. & A. Martien was active between 1856 and 1864, although some of the portraits may date from either before or after that period.
An index (handwritten on forms printed in gold, [4] leaves) is inserted at the front of the volume, following the title leaf. Most of the photographs also have handwritten captions.
The title and index leaves have decorative borders.
The album leaves have four double-sided rounded rectangular openings, each measuring 8 x 5 cm., cut into laminated sheets of paperboard, with triple gilt borders printed around each opening.
Some brief newsclippings (obituaries) and biographical citations about the subjects are tipped- or laid-in.
